What is the definition of experimental logic?

The term "experimental logic" doesn't have a widely recognized or established definition within the traditional fields of logic or philosophy. It's not a standard term.

However, there are several ways the term could be interpreted, based on how "experimental" and "logic" are used:

Possible Interpretations:

* Logic as a tool for analyzing experiments: This approach uses logic to formalize and reason about the design and interpretation of experiments. It's similar to the use of statistical methods in experimental design, but focuses on the logical structure of the experimental process.

* Experimental approaches to studying cognition: This is more common in the fields of cognitive psychology and cognitive science. Researchers use experiments to study how people reason, solve problems, and make decisions. They use logic as a framework for analyzing the results of these experiments.

* Informal or "experimental" logics: Some philosophers and logicians have proposed new systems of logic that are more "experimental" in the sense that they are less concerned with formal rigor and more focused on exploring new concepts or ideas.

In Summary:

There is no one definitive definition of "experimental logic." It's a term that can be used in different ways depending on the context. If you're encountering this term, it's important to understand the specific context in which it's being used to determine its meaning.
